Suzuki - Passenger seat occupant detection system may fail

An official NHTSA notice concerns Suzuki - Passenger seat occupant detection system may fail. In the event of a crash necessitating airbag deployment, an incorrect classification may result in the passenger frontal air bag deploying even if there is a child in the front passenger seat, increasing their risk of injury. Published 2019-03-07.
What to do now
Suzuki will notify owners, and dealers will replace the seat bottom cushion, free of charge. Interim owner notification letters were mailed on may 3, 2019. All second letters notifying owners of the remedy were mailed by april 10, 2020. Owners may contact suzuki customer service at 1-800-934-0934. Suzuki's numbers for this recall are 4011 and 4012.
